    I tried to get on my website this morning and got this error: Fatal error: Cannot redeclare sdec() (previously declared in /home/adapdjxk/public_html/wp-includes/vars.php:110) in /home/adapdjxk/public_html/wp-includes/vars.php on line 177

    I haven’t made any changes since the last time I was on it. Any ideas? I can’t sign in and make any changes either.

    I think I figured it out, download a fresh copy of wordpress

    extract it anywhere, locate the vars.php file, which is located in the file path public_html/wp-includes/vars.php.

    Then connect via FTP to your website files, and navigate to that same folder and replace it. It worked for me!
